Benefits of using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) tool In Supply Chain Management


Benefits of using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) tool
In
Supply Chain Management

 The Internet's value-added chain covers both the upstream and downstream business through which a
product travels — from raw materials to manufacturing and from manufacturing to marketing and aftersales service. At each stage of operation, an intermediary performs functions that add value to products and services, facilitate their flow, and compensate for them through a counter flow of money.

A contribution of the Internet supply chain is to eliminate paperwork and cut overhead in both directions of this flow.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) software application have being built and improved upon over the year to facilitate operations such as Supply Chain Management (SCM), Logistics, Financial Management, Warehousing Management, Project Management, Customer Relationship Management, etc.in its full cycle of operational documentation, processes and quality reporting.

What you should appreciate in this information age is that while Internet commerce helps to reduce the involvement of intermediaries, greater efficiency skill enhancement round around time and increase value to customers.

Benefits of Implementing ERP software in Supply Chain Management (SCM), Logistics, Warehouse Management and Financial Management:
1.     It helps the human resources, organization and industry to re-engineer their processes, learning & professional skills to work efficiently and adopt new standards.
2.     It helps to increase the Return On Investment (ROI) for the government and business owners
3.     Reduction in overhead financing and increased productivity most especially in the aspect of documentation, reporting and communication.
4.     Business process integration with other units, departments, partner companies, etc. example of such activity the maximization of information technology in DHL  Courier company, such that customers can view & track their goods/consignments via the internet which is integrated with their ERP applications.
5.     Complete visibility of all activities captured within the ERP software. Government of Today should harness  ERP technology for activities such as:
a.       Project Management: All project across all ministries, states and the entire country can be capture and track and monitored via an Enterprise Project Management Module of an ERP. The project owners, vendors, budget and actual cost, etc. will   give the Government online real-time reports.

b.      Supply Chain activities on the commodities like AGO from production - to – revenue.
